Cuba ready to celebrate Havana International Fair 2022

feria-habana-580x435

To date, some 60 countries will be present at the 38th edition of the Havana International Fair (Fihav), the head of Foreign Trade and Foreign Investment of Cuba, Rodrigo Malmierca, highlighted today. Malmierca highlighted that the event, to be held from November 14 to 18 at the Expocuba fairgrounds, will be attended by top-level delegations chaired by ministers and high-ranking government officials. Cuba Supports Latin American Vision of Development Goals

malmierca

Cuba has called for Latin American and Caribbean vision in the implementation of the 2030 Agenda for Sustainable Development, approved by the General Assembly of the United Nations. The statement was made by the Minister of Foreign Trade and Foreign Investment (MINCEX), Rodrigo Malmierca, who heads the Cuban delegation to the 36th session of the United Nations Economic Commission for Latin America and the Caribbean (ECLAC), which concluded Friday.

Malmierca: Obama has support to continue dismantling the blockade

Malmierca reunion Penny Washington

President Barack Obama has the necessary support to continue dismantling the blockade, the main obstacle to improving relations between Cuba and the United States, Cuban Foreign Trade and Investment Minister, Rodrigo Malmierca, assured his U.S. counterpart Penny Pritzker in Washington yesterday.

Cuban Minister of Foreign Trade and Investment to visit U.S.

marmierca y Penny

Cuban Minister of Foreign Trade and Investment (Mincex), Rodrigo Malmierca Díaz, will make a working visit to the U.S., February 15-18, leading a delegation of representatives from Mincex, the Ministry of Foreign Relations, the Central Bank of Cuba, the Cuban Chamber of Commerce and directors of national entities, according to the Cubaminrex website.
